If you Consider the fact that Mercedes-Benz had made multi spoke wheels for a lot of their cars over the years why is it just this 19 inch wheel for the C 63 AMG? Look at the SLS AMG look at the CLK AMG they have many different kinds of multi spoke wheels available for their cars before, have we had any damage or breakage in the past?
And, for what it's worth, I suspect that most people with the 19" run lower tire pressures than what is recommended for 19" wheels and the weight of the car (45 psi f/r is what 19" wheels call for), which severely compromises the ability of the tire to absorb anything but the smallest imperfection on the pavement. If you're running 39 psi on 19s, a patched-up pothole or a manhole cover that you hit at speed would be enough for the rim to actually make contact with the pavement. Of course they're going to crack.
Not defending MB nor saying that the wheels are not weak or possibly even defective, but you have to take this into account when running stretched rubber bands instead of tires.

Given the condition of most public roads, cracking (or bending) a 19" wheel is just a matter of time. While wheels can be repaired by welding, heating, and bending this is a very dangerous option. Welding heats the metal beyond the temperature is was originally formed at (this applies to both cast and forged wheels). While the damaged portion is repaired the surrounding area is compromised. More catastrophic failures could occur to a welded wheel. The repaired wheel will most likely be out of round and significantly out of balance beyond the point of what wheel weights are designed to correct. Many AMG wheel are cast and cost upwards of $1,000 each. This is way overpriced. I would suggest, if you must have 19" wheel, you find an quality aftermarket set of wheels that when the bend or crack (which they will) it is much cheaper just to replace the damaged wheel. Three piece wheels are a more costly option as the center are usually forged and the outers (which take the beating) are spun cast and can be replaced without buying an entire new wheel.

If you know anything about metal grain structures and stresses in aluminum and its alloys, it would be pretty obvious that there are massive problems with your statement. Even powder-coating is sometimes enough to weaken a wheel, and that's uniformly heating the entire wheel at once. Once you start heating only portions of the metal (as well as altering the composition at the welding seam), the entire molecular structure changes in the surrounding area which in aluminum plays havoc with the stress distribution in the area. What ends up happening is that the surrounding area gets progressively weaker until you end up with a fatigue break.
This is not only my opinion, but that of a very good friend of mine (also a gearhead) who has been working for Rolls-Royce Aerospace doing fatigue analysis in various alloys for a living. I take it he knows his metallurgy a little better than your welder.
